Retail Operations Executive Interview Questions
Basic Retail Operations Executive Interview Questions
- Describe the primary responsibilities of a Retail Operations Executive in a multi-store environment.
- What key performance indicators would you monitor to assess store operations performance?
- How do you prioritize competing requests from merchandising, sales, and logistics teams?
- Explain your experience with inventory management and how you prevent out-of-stocks and overstock.
- How do you ensure compliance with company policies and regulatory requirements at store level?
- Describe how you would support store managers to improve customer service consistency.
- What role should technology play in daily retail operations?
- How do you measure and manage shrinkage and loss prevention in retail stores?
Intermediate Retail Operations Executive Interview Questions
- A region reports a sudden 8 percent drop in sales over a month. How would you investigate and address the issue?
- You discover repeated inventory discrepancies across several stores. What steps would you take to identify root causes and correct them?
- A promotional campaign is planned in two weeks but supply is delayed. How do you adjust operations to minimize impact?
- Describe a time you optimized store staffing to reduce labor costs while maintaining service levels. What metrics did you use?
- A new point of sale system will be rolled out across 50 stores. How would you plan the rollout to minimize disruption?
- You must reduce operating expenses by 5 percent without closing stores. What operational levers would you consider?
- How would you design a plan for cross-store inventory transfers to support high-demand locations during peak season?
- Describe how you would implement a quality control program for store standards and visual merchandising.
- How do you track and improve first contact resolution for store-related operational issues?
- Explain a situation where you led a process improvement that increased store throughput or customer conversion.
Advanced Retail Operations Executive Interview Questions
- Outline a multi-year operational strategy to scale stores while preserving unit economics and customer experience.
- How would you architect an omnichannel operations model that unifies inventory, fulfillment, and returns across channels?
- Describe an approach to demand forecasting that reduces excess inventory while ensuring in-stock availability for top sellers.
- What metrics and dashboards would you build for senior leadership to monitor operational health across regions?
- Explain how you would lead change management for a major operations transformation affecting store teams and logistics partners.
- How do you evaluate and select third-party logistics or distribution partners to support retail expansion?
- Propose a framework to optimize gross margin through pricing, promotions, and operational cost controls.
- Describe how you would design a training and development program to scale store manager capabilities across regions.
- Explain a method to integrate loss prevention, safety, and compliance into daily store operations at scale.
- How would you apply automation or analytics to reduce manual tasks and improve decision making in store operations?
Pre-Screening Video Interview Questions for Retail Operations Executive
These pre-screening questions are ideal for one-way video interviews on ScreeningHive. Use them to quickly assess candidates on communication, operational thinking, and cultural fit before advancing to live interviews.
- Briefly describe your experience managing operations across multiple store locations and the size of the teams you supervised.
This question evaluates candidate background, scale experience, and ability to communicate managerial scope clearly.
- Describe a specific operational challenge you resolved that improved store performance. What actions did you take and what were the results?
This question assesses problem solving, result orientation, and ability to summarize an impact-focused case.
- How do you prioritize inventory accuracy, labor scheduling, and customer service when you have limited resources?
This question evaluates decision making, prioritization skills, and alignment with operational trade offs.
- Explain how you would prepare stores for a major seasonal peak while minimizing stockouts and excess markdowns.
This question measures planning ability, forecasting understanding, and operational foresight.
- What technology or tools have you used to monitor and improve store operations, and how did they change outcomes?
This question checks technical familiarity, adoption mindset, and evidence of measurable improvements.
